Who is Dr. Macdonald, Adolescent Medicine Specialist in Goldsboro, NC?
Dr. Katherine Macdonald, MD is an Adolescent Medicine Specialist, who primarily practices in Goldsboro, NC. She has been practicing for over 17 years and is board certified. Dr. Macdonald graduated from The Brody School Of Medicine At East Carolina University and completed her residency at Children's Hospital Oakland.

Is this Dr. Katherine Macdonald aff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?
Yes, Dr. Macdonald is affiliated with WakeMed Raleigh Campus which is a Castle Connolly
Top Hospital.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their
exc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through
a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ise.
The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the
top 25% nationwide.
